Kevin rode 24 km in 2 hours. At that rate, how long would it take him to ride 120 km?

Answer:

10 hours

Step-by-step explanation:

We can convert the speed to km/h, and to do this, you simply have to find the amount Kevin rides in 1 hour. So,

24/2 = x/1

x = 12

So, now we see that Kevin rides at approximately 12 kmph. Now, instead of finding the distance, we need to find the hour at 120 km.

12/1 = 120/x

x = 10
